body { font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 12px; color: #000000; text-align: center; margin: 0; padding: 0; }
#wrapper { text-align: left; margin-right: auto; margin-left: auto; position: relative; width: 775px; height: auto; }
a:link {text-decoration: none; color: #003366;}
a:active {text-decoration: none; color: #003366;}
a:visited {text-decoration: none; color: #003366;}
a:hover {text-decoration: underline; color: #99CC33;}
a.none:link, a.none:active, a.none:visited { text-decoration: none; color: #00316E;}
a.none:hover { text-decoration: none; color: #99CC33;}
p { margin-top: 8px; margin-bottom: 8px; }
img { border: 0; }
#date { position: absolute; z-index: 3; color: #FFFFFF; margin: 15px 0 0 272px; font-weight: bold; width: 135px; text-align: right; }
.right { padding-right: 4px; }
.middleright { padding-right: 4px; background: url(/images/title-middle-right.gif) top left repeat-y; }
#domain { margin: 10px; }
#domain p { text-align: right; color: #00316E; font-weight: bold; font-size: 11px; padding-top: 7px; }
#domain img { float: left; }
p.selectall { margin-top: 12px; margin-bottom: 8px; }
table { border: 0; clear: left; }
ul { list-style-type: none; margin: 0; padding: 0; }
li { margin: 0px 0px 15px 0px; }
input, select { font-size: 11px; }
.BigResults { font-weight: bold; font-size: 13px; }
.sponsored { font-weight: bold; color: #6D6D6D; }
.arrow { float: right; margin: 3px 12px 0px 0px; }
#domainsearch { font-family: Arial, Helvetica, sans-serif; color: #00316E; font-size: 11px; margin-left: 5px; position: absolute; width: 160px; line-height: 16px; }
.searchtop { font-family: Verdana, Arial, Helvetica, sans-serif; color: #00316E; margin-left: 5px; font-weight: bold; font-size: 11px; }
.textinput { width: 143px; }
.divider { background-color: #DDDDDD; width: 140px; height: 4px; line-height: 4px; margin: 22px 0px 22px 10px; padding: 0px; }
.rdivider { background-color: #DDDDDD;  width: 120px; height: 4px; line-height: 4px; margin: 22px 0px 22px 8px; padding: 0px; }
#callingcodes { color: #065CC5; font-style: italic; font-weight: bold; font-size: 12px; margin-left: 5px; }
#callingcodes p { margin-top: 6px; margin-bottom: 4px; }
.ccc { margin-left: 13px; }
.free { margin-left: 5px; }
.select { width: 153px; }
option { width: 200px; }
.hide { display: none; }
.lookup{ margin: 10px 0px 0px 36px; }
.leftcol { margin-left: 19px; }
.leftcol2 { margin: 0px 19px 0px 19px; padding: 0px 0px 6px 0px; width: 120px;  background-color: #EDEDED; }
.rad { margin-left: 9px; }
.rad2 { margin-left: 9px; margin-bottom: 5px; }
#random { margin-top: 18px; padding: 0; }
.footer { text-align: center; color: #6D6D6D; font-size: 11px; padding: 10px; }
.footer a:link, .footer a:active, .footer a:visited { text-decoration: none; color: #6D6D6D;}
.footer a:hover { text-decoration: none; color: #00316E;}
.ckbx { margin: 0px; padding: 0px; width: 13px; height: 13px; line-height: 13px; overflow: hidden; }
.ckbx2 { margin: 0px 0px 0px 15px; padding: 0px; width: 13px; height: 13px; line-height: 13px; overflow: hidden; }
.ckbx3 { margin: 0px 0px 0px 23px; padding: 0px; width: 13px; height: 13px; line-height: 13px; overflow: hidden; }
.ckbx4 { margin: 0px 0px 0px 21px; padding: 0px; width: 13px; height: 13px; line-height: 13px; overflow: hidden; }
.ckbx5 { margin: 0px 0px 0px 26px; padding: 0px; width: 13px; height: 13px; line-height: 13px; overflow: hidden; }
.ckbx6 { margin: 0px 0px 0px 26px; padding: 0px; width: 13px; height: 13px; line-height: 13px; overflow: hidden; }
.ckbx7 { margin: 0px 0px 0px 20px; padding: 0px; width: 13px; height: 13px; line-height: 13px; overflow: hidden; }
.ckbx8 { margin: 0px 0px 0px 9px; padding: 0px; width: 13px; height: 13px; line-height: 13px; overflow: hidden; }
.ckbx9 { margin: 0px 0px 0px 8px; padding: 0px; width: 13px; height: 13px; line-height: 13px; overflow: hidden; }
.search { float: right; margin: -1px 15px 0px 0px; padding: 0; }
#misclinks { font-size: 11px; margin-left: 8px; font-weight: bold; line-height: 19px; }
.next { background: url(/images/point.gif) 0px 2px no-repeat; padding-left: 8px; }
.next2 { background: url(/images/point.gif) 20px 2px no-repeat; padding-left: 28px; }

.randomimage { border: 2px solid #00316E; margin: 10px 0 10px 0; width: 405px; height: 200px; position: relative; left: 10px; }
.sponsored { padding-left: 10px; }
#ppc { width: 430px; }
p.ppctitle { width: 350px; margin: 0; padding: 0; }
a.ppctitle:link, a.ppctitle:active, a.ppctitle:visited  { text-decoration: none; color: #00316E; font-weight: bold; width: 350px; margin: 0; padding: 0; }
a.ppctitle:hover { text-decoration: underline; color: #99CC33; font-weight: bold; width: 350px; margin: 0; padding: 0; }

ul, li { list-style-type: none; margin: 0; padding: 0; }
li a:link, li a:active, li a:visited { list-style-type: none; list-style-position: outside; margin-left: 0; margin-top: 13px; padding-left: 10px; display: block; width: 420px;  }
li a:hover { background: url(/images/hover.gif) top left repeat-y; list-style-type: none; list-style-position: outside; margin-left: 0; margin-top: 13px;  padding-left: 10px; display: block; width: 420px; text-decoration: none; cursor: pointer; }
.description { color: #000000; text-decoration: none; margin: 0px; border: 0; font-weight: normal; width: 400px; }
a.description:hover { color:#000000; text-decoration: none; margin: 0px; border: 0; font-weight: normal; width: 400px; cursor: pointer; }
a.description:active, a.description:visited, a.description:link, { color:#000000; text-decoration: none; margin: 0px; border: 0; font-weight: normal; width: 400px; }
.sublink { font-size: 10px; color: #6D6D6D; text-decoration: none; }
a.sublink:hover { font-size: 10px; color: #6D6D6D; text-decoration: none; cursor: pointer; }

.newcat { padding-left: 1px; }
#categories { text-align: center; float: left; margin: 2px 10px 0px 0px; position: relative; left: 40px; color: #00316E; font-weight: bold; font-size: 11px; line-height: 17px; }
.more { margin: 0px 0px 1px 0px; color: #6D6D6D; }
#searchgoogle { float: right; border: 1px solid #808080; margin: 10px 5px 7px 0px; }
#sbi { position: relative; top: 4px; width: 136px; }
#sbb { position: relative; top: 4px; }
a.privacy { font-size: 11px; color: #3D599C; margin-left: 40px; }
